Repair of windows made of Upvc: Cost

The price of window repair near me will be based on the kind of windows you own and the amount of work required. Repairs for double-pane windows are generally more expensive than repairs of single-pane windows.

You might need to replace your window's seals and hinges. Broken springs in the window can cause the sash of the window to stick when you open the window. A lock or handle that is broken will make your window an easy target for burglars.

There are a variety of reasons your windows need to be repaired. Some of them are broken or cracked panes, misaligned or loose hinges, and broken glass. Other causes are faulty seals, or a defective balance or spring.

If you're looking for an affordable method to repair your window, a DIY upvc window repair can be the answer. Before you begin you must know how much you'll have to spend on the repairs.

It's less expensive to replace a single pane of glass than to replace a whole windows according to the majority of homeowners. It is possible to save hundreds of dollars by repairing your windows instead of replacing them.

However, the cost of replacing a damaged frame could be very costly. They can be expensive due to the possibility of wood rot resulting from exposure to moisture. If you decide to replace the frame, you'll need to take out all the rotten sections and replace them with new wood.

Depending on the size and condition of your windows, you can expect to shell out between $75 and $300 for them to be repaired. It is crucial to keep in mind that you will need two people to fix your windows. If you have more than one window, you'll save money.

If you need to replace your window screen, you'll be required to purchase the screen itself. Prices for screens differ based on the thickness and the material. Screen replacements range from $150 and $350.
